Ian Machado Garry is oozing confidence as he takes on a surging contender at UFC on ESPN 66. Machado Garry (15-1 MMA, 8-1 UFC) faces Carlos Prates (21-6 MMA, 4-0 UFC) in the April 26 welterweight main event at T-Mobile Center in Kansas City, Mo. Prates has been on a tear since joining the UFC roster, scoring four knockouts and four Performance of the Night bonuses. Machado Garry knows the Brazilian is dangerous but has a gut feeling that he’ll emerge victorious in emphatic fashion. “I think he’s been successful, I think he’s done very well, and there’s a reason he’s on a 10-fight knockout streak, and fair play to him,” Machado Garry said on “The Ariel Helwani Show.” “That’s great. I think his team is phenomenal, I love watching his team, I think his team are awesome.
